The Feature of a Title Firm
While a real estate attorney offers legal advice, a title business plays an essential function in making certain the purchase's authenticity.
When you're getting or marketing building, the title business carries out an extensive title search. This process helps recognize any liens, cases, or encumbrances on the residential or commercial property, ensuring you understand any kind of possible issues.
They likewise take care of the closing process, handling the needed documents and funds for the purchase. Furthermore, title firms provide title insurance policy, safeguarding you and your loan provider from future cases versus the residential or commercial property.
This protection gives you peace of mind, knowing that your ownership is secure. Generally, the title company's functions are essential for a smooth and stress-free realty transaction.
Key Differences Between a Realty Attorney and a Title Company
Recognizing the functions of both a real estate attorney and a title company can help you navigate the complexities of building deals.
A realty legal representative concentrates on lawful facets, such as drafting contracts, offering legal guidance, and resolving disputes. They ensure your interests are safeguarded throughout the procedure.
On the other hand, a title business mainly takes care of the title search and closing procedure. They verify the residential or commercial property's title, handle escrow accounts, and assist in the transfer of possession.
While a title business can assist make sure a smooth purchase, they do not offer lawful recommendations or depiction. So, if legal concerns develop, having a realty attorney is important for protecting your investment and guaranteeing conformity with neighborhood legislations.
